What is LightGuard?
LightGuard is the low light image processing technology that combines a large sensor with fast shutter speed and large aperture lens together with AI-based image enhancement, in order to provide undisputable evidence and identity of the moving targets.

The moving objects at night are the challenge for most surveillance cameras in the world. When there is not enough light, the conventional camera would gain more light by using slower shutter speed. That however will make the moving objects appear as blurred. When the moving object is blur then it is impossible to identify it.

It is extremely important to have clearly identifiable images, so that the faces or the license plates of the vehicles can clearly be identified even when they are moving fast in the darkness.

The LightGuard technology is able to produce the clear evidence even in the darkness. The license plate of the vehicle will be clearly enhanced with the help of the sensor, lens and AI, so that it is possible to read it even when the vehicles is driving very fast at night.

The LightGuard camera prioritizes the identity of the targets rather than the overall appearance of the image.

Its newest algorithm is capable of efficiently reducing any noise or blur while increasing the sharpness of the objects. As a result, any license plate, facial details or other smaller but important objects become much more distinguishable. You can evaluate the lack of noise by checking the Signal-to-Noise ratio (S/N ratio) of the camera.

Applications

The most typical application is the monitoring of the night-time traffic. Every moving vehicle can clearly be identified. Especially, the license plate of each vehicle will be clearly readable even in the darkness.

The LightGuard cameras can be used in the wide range of night-time monitoring applications, including city surveillance, parking lots, retail stores, schools and others.
